The history of this Toronto Public Library branch has gone through a few location and name changes since the formal opening in January 1956. Back then, it was part of the Borough of Scarborough and was named the Golden Mile Branch. Fast forward to April 1983, it relocated to the new wing & present location in the Eglinton Square Shopping Centre just off the food court. A facility expansion took place between 2016/2017. Community patrons can now enjoy seating for 115 (pre-pandemic), 2 quiet study rooms, 2 meeting rooms for lectures or classroom configuration based on booking needs, 11 workstations with internet, WiFi, and scanning/copying/printing services. Persons with disabilities have access to special equipment including computer with screen magnification software, large print keyboard, large trackball mouse, magnifier, page turner, book stand, and wheelchair accessible furniture. This is great as many of us take this part of life for granted. Parking is free. TTC bus service, including the soon to be completed Line 5 Eglinton Crosstown is close by. Never stop learning!

This library went through a recent renovation and upgrade. It took many months to finish the upgrade but it was well worth it. The place now looks so modern with new furniture and equipment. Self check out is available too. Staff are knowledgeable and helpful. There are study rooms too but but I never used them. The place cannot be ideal for people who are looking for quiet times. It is right beside the food court which is busy all time with people having their meals or just hanging out there.

Over the summer months this location has been quite pleasant. I did have to ask 2 ladies to stop talking so loudly- both on their phones & talking to each other simultaneously in one of the glassed study rooms. You do need to check your chair for food, spilled coffee etc. before sitting down. (You need to pass through the food court to enter the library and some do feal it's OK to have a full meal while handling books). The staff are quiet, keep their heads down & do their work but will help you find something you need. Remember to say hello with a smile when you see them. I'd give this location 5 stars but T.P.L policy has changed from a library that was a place to respect that others are trying to study & learn to eating full meals, phone's ringing non-stop & talking loudly. Bring earplugs, sanitizer & napkins & you'll survive the T.P.L.
